This Global Certificate Course in Cutting-Edge Nanoscale Spectroscopy provides comprehensive training in advanced spectroscopic techniques for nanoscale analysis. Participants will gain practical expertise in various methods and their applications in diverse fields.
Learning outcomes include mastering data acquisition and interpretation from instruments like atomic force microscopy (AFM), scanning tunneling microscopy (STM), and near-field scanning optical microscopy (NSOM). The course also covers essential theoretical concepts of nanoscale spectroscopy, including surface plasmon resonance (SPR) and Raman spectroscopy.
